If you're poorly prepared, travelling can be a real challenge. But don't hit the panic button just yet. Follow these handy tips and enjoy a trouble-free start to your getaway in Bac Lieu. What to pack in your hand luggage:
- Flying can be a comfortable experience if you bring the right gear. First of all you'll need basic toiletries, such as deodorant, toothpaste and a toothbrush, a spare set of clothes and a few magazines. Next, leave space in your hand luggage for your phone and charger, your important medications and perhaps a neck pillow too. Lastly, be sure to take your passport, travel docs and your bank cards.
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:
- Pack all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and conditioner in your checked luggage. Any liquids or gels in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ated by authorities. Sharp or pointed objects, like a Swiss Army knife, and dangerous goods which are flammable or explosive, such as spray paint, flares and matches, are also not allowed.
What to wear on a flight:
- Comfort should be your main priority when deciding what to wear on board. Loose, breathable clothing is a sensible choice, as are flat, slip-on shoes.
- Caused by lengthy periods of inactivity, de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a blood clot condition that can affect passengers during long-haul flights. Lower your risks by staying hydrated, keeping your legs and feet moving and wearing compression socks to help your circulation.
